Asia’s Richest Village in Himachal Pradesh

To make money in today’s world, people must put forth a lot of effort. In such a setting, a Himachal Pradesh village serves as an example today. We’re talking about a village in Shimla, which is around 92 kilometers from Shimla. Let us inform you that the farmers in this area have done an excellent job. Yes, Madavag was named India’s richest village in 2019, and this is due to the farmers’ cultivation of apples. They produced roughly 7 lakh boxes of apples per year, and the farmers became wealthy as a result of their efforts.

There are no industrialists or people working for well-known companies in this area, but each family’s annual income ranges from 70 to 75 lakh rupees, which is shocking. Let us inform you that the farmers of Madavag grow the highest quality apples, such as Royal Apple, Red Gold, and Gail Gala. With this, there was no indication of apples until 1989, and when a farmer attempted in 1990, he was successful.

People began planting apples at the same time, and the Madavag apple is quite huge. These apples are of such high quality that they do not deteriorate rapidly, and people tend to their apple orchards as if they were children.

SHIMLA

The village of Madavag is located at a height of 7774 feet & 92 km away from Shimla has neither industrialists nor people in high companies in high ranks yet it is among the richest villages in Asia. Here, the annual income of each family is between 70 and 75 lakh. This is the result of their hard work put into apple orchards.

There was no apple in the village until the 80s

Currently, at present, the apple crop has started coming to the village and it is expected that this year a population of 1800 will produce about 7 lakh boxes of apples of the best quality apples in the country. Farmers have planted varieties like Royal Apple, Red Geld, and Gail Gala. The village did not have even a single apple until the 80s. In 1990, farmer Hira Singh Dogra brought apple plants for the first time. When their experiment was successful the whole village started growing apples.  He says that today 12 to 15 lakh box apples from the Madavag Panchayat go throughout the world every year.

Olay trees are maintained throughout the year to protect against snowfall

The size of Madavag’s apples is quite large. Apples do not spoil quickly because of the quality of apple production here is so good due to good snowfall. People take good care of apple orchards as their own children. In the winter, the gardens remain strong day and night. People remove snow from trees at below zero degree temperatures. The crop is ready from April to August-September. In the meantime, if hail falls, the entire crop may be ruined that’s why nets are planted all over above the gardens to protect crops from the hailstorm.

The apple here is famous in the world

Shimla, Himachal Pradesh is famous all over the world for apple cultivation. The apples here are well-liked abroad. Let us know that Madavag village here is also considered as the richest village in Asia. Apple cultivation has made this village a major development of about 150 crore apple in a year. In 1970 in Madavag, the gardener Moti Ram Mehta has sold apples worth Rs. 10,000/-. He planted apple

Till now, Madavag has become Asia’s richest village. Earlier than this, the title of the richest village of Himachal was with Kiari village in Shimla district in the year 1982.

– Madavag village falls in the Chaupal tehsil of Shimla district.

– It has a population of about 2 thousand.

– 150 crore rupees apple is produced here every year.

– The annual income of each family in this village is close to 7.5 million.

-About 400 families live in the Madavag district in Himachal.
